A Late Edo to Meiji Period, 19th century suite of ten highly details silk paintings depicting various Noh performances and scenes, all accentuated and highlighted with gold.
There is significant attention to detail in each painting, with the vestments, kimonos, and masks all heavily detailed, with some degree of shading techniques used.
Each silk painting has been backed with paper for preservation and is bordered with gold.
Ten silk paintings, 24.1 x 29 cm
These paintings are in very good shape, with very little wear or staining to eight of them. One of the paintings has suffered a bit of damage to the verso, almost forming a tear, but this is not as noticeable to the recto. A few of the backing papers are torn, but the silk paintings are unaffected.
